[Impact]
In utopic more c32 files need linking to ensure live-build can come up
with a working syslinux installation. Without the additional links live-
build and thus ubuntu-defaults-image will create ISOs with a disfunct
syslinux erroring out when trying to load the c32s in question.
This does not affect ubuntu-cdimage as that one copies specific c32s
manually.
The fix for this problem is to link all c32s ubuntu-cdimage copies.
[Test Case]
* sudo ubuntu-defaults-image --release utopic --package ubuntu-desktop --flavor
ubuntu --components main,restricted,universe,multiverse
* boot created iso
